先上进度条样式: 再上效果: 在平时开发中,常常遇到一些特殊需求,就比方我今天写的这篇。UI设计让我必须搞一个圆角的进度条,虽然不是特别难,但本着方便你我,下次使用拿来主义,...
先上进度条样式: 再上效果: 在平时开发中,常常遇到一些特殊需求,就比方我今天写的这篇。UI设计让我必须搞一个圆角的进度条,虽然不是特别难,但本着方便你我,下次使用拿来主义,...
在 Android 中,AppCompatImageView 中设置的 src 资源如果带有透明度,再设置 tint 色值时可能会遇到一些问题。具体来说,tint 会叠加到原...
继上次使用自定义TextView展示内容后,产品觉得效果不太好,不能动态添加分隔线,这不,又要求我做更智能一些,怀着不断学习和为公司着想的理念,我又有了一个大胆的想法:使用跨...
根据项目需求:1.TextView可以显示带Html标签,如 / 等标签相关的文本。2.可以不断往文本下面添加新的带标签内容。3.手指在触摸滑动内容时可以让文本上下滚动。4....
有时候在开发应用程序时需要监听App当前处于前台还是后台来做一些处理,下面代码可作为参考: leaveApp()则表示应用当前的状态为进入后台。
Android 10之前 Environment.getExternalStoragePublicDirectory(Environment.DIRECTORY_PICTUR...
在 Android 中,要判断一个 View 是否被曝光,通常可以通过以下几种方式实现: 使用 View 的 getGlobalVisibleRect() 方法来获取该 Vi...
以下是一个简单的 MVVM 样例,其中使用了 Kotlin 和 Android 的 Jetpack 组件,包括 Room、ViewModel 和 LiveData。 创建一个...
先以一个例子看下效果 room 中在插入数据方法上加@Insert(onConflict = OnConflictStrategy.REPLACE)的作用是什么? @Inse...
在 Android Kotlin 中,给 ViewModel 传值有多种方式。这里列出了几种常见的方式: 使用 ViewModel 的构造函数传值:可以在 ViewModel...
Okio 是一个现代化的 I/O 库,用于在 Java 应用程序中进行高效的读写操作。它提供了一些简单且易于使用的 API,以帮助您更轻松地管理数据流,并提供了一些有用的功能...
创建一个简单的线程池 在Android中,可以使用Java中的Executor框架来创建线程池和调度异步任务。下面是一个简单的示例代码,演示如何创建一个线程池方法并调度一个异...
这个报错信息表明 Firebase Installations SDK 没有能够获取到安装授权令牌。这通常是因为 Firebase Installations SDK 被阻止...
断言 断言是一个逻辑判断,用于检查不应该发生的情况Assert 关键字在 JDK1.4 中引入,可通过 JVM 参数-enableassertions开启SpringBoot...
以下是用Java实现将JSON字符串格式化为文本的功能的代码: 这里使用了com.fasterxml.jackson.databind.ObjectMapper库来处理JSO...
位于Thread类里面的interrupt()方法,它的作用就是中断线程。 从两个方面演示该方法。 1.停止正在运行的线程。2.停止休眠中的线程 为什么一直打印?因为inte...
例如现在有两个线程T1&T2T1的作用是一个给value赋值的功能。T2的作用是一当T1value被赋值完成后打印value值的功能。 现实当中,有许多场景会用到类似的功能。...
真牛
你到底写了个啥
啥啥啥啊?你说了又好像什么也没说,有点职业精神好吧 谢谢